2016-02-01から1ヶ月間の記事一覧
A: おはよう #include<stdio.h> #include<algorithm> using namespace std; int t[]={100000,50000,30000,20000,10000}; int ans[200]; int main(){ int a;scanf("%d",&a); for(int i=0;i<min(a,5);i++){ int b;scanf("%d",&b);b--; ans[b]+=t[i]; } for(int i=0;i<a;i++)printf("%d\n",ans[i]); } B: 誤読した #include<stdio.h> #…</min(a,5);i++){></algorithm></stdio.h>
待ち受ける大きな罠 (誤差)に気を取られていると足元(添え字)がおろそかになるんじゃ。 #include<stdio.h> #include<algorithm> #include<math.h> #include<vector> using namespace std; long double x[110]; long double y[110]; long double r[110]; const long double EPS = 1e-20; const lon</vector></math.h></algorithm></stdio.h>…
A: おおっとりあえずメモ化探索しよ #include<stdio.h> #include<algorithm> #include<map> #include<vector> using namespace std; map<long long,int> dp; vector<long long>hb; long long calc(long long a){ if(dp.count(a))return dp[a]; long long best=a; for(int i=0;i<hb.size();i++){ if(hb[i]>a)continue; long long cost=a%hb[…</hb.size();i++){></long></long></vector></map></algorithm></stdio.h>
PCK2014本選の問題が今までFrameしかなかったが、最近他も追加されたので全部解いた。 0305: Yuekis' Audio Room やるだけ。 #include<stdio.h> #include<algorithm> using namespace std; int main(){ int a;scanf("%d",&a); while(a--){ int r,t; scanf("%d%d",&r,&t); if(r%10</algorithm></stdio.h>…
典型面倒データ構造。クソ。 各ステップに面倒要素が搭載されており、やる気を的確に削いでくる。というかこういう問題で何やっても通るようなサンプル置くのは何なの……Starry Sky木の更新条件をすっかり忘れていた。 #include<stdio.h> #include<algorithm> using namespace std</algorithm></stdio.h>…